Australia soars into Eurovision final as UK song debuts

Summary

Australia's singer Delta Goodrem qualified for the Eurovision Song Contest final after a strong performance of her song "Eclipse." The United Kingdom's entry automatically advanced to the final because it is one of the main financial supporters of the contest.

Key Facts

  • Delta Goodrem is a famous Australian pop singer known for many hit albums.
  • Australia joined Eurovision in 2015 as a special guest and has stayed in the contest since then.
  • Goodrem's song "Eclipse" made Australia one of the favorites to win this year.
  • The UK’s contestant performed in the semi-final but automatically goes to the final due to the UK's financial support role.
  • Ten countries qualified for the Eurovision final from this semi-final round.
  • Five countries, including Azerbaijan and Latvia, were eliminated and must wait until 2027 to compete again.
  • Eurovision is popular in Australia, with over a million viewers tuning in regularly.
  • The Eurovision final will take place in Vienna on Saturday.
